Note:
๐ Important Safety Reminders:
- Please note that we do require reusable swim diapers (no disposable) in our pool; they hold in the contaminates best!
- For safety purposes, we require at least one adult to be in the water with each child who cannot swim independently during the open swim.
- Adults are required to remain in facility with minors.
- Only proper swim attire is permitted in the pool; no street clothes permitted.
๐๐ฝ SWIM TEST REQUIRED
- Our pool is 4'2'' deep. All children that cannot touch with their head above water will be required to pass a swim test at the start of open swim. In order to pass a swim test, the child must swim 25 feet across the width of the pool without struggle; Ellis Certified Lifeguard will make final determination.
- Lifejackets or puddle jumpers that fasten around the center are required for all children that do not pass. Coast guard approved life jackets are available at the facility.
- If a guardian chooses to accompany the child in the pool 100% of the time, they may remove floatation and practice swim skills with a parent.
- We do not allow single arm floaties that do not buckle around the chest for additional support.
